QAGOMA welcomes 500,000 visitors for APT8

QAGOMA welcomes 500,000 visitors for APT8
March 19, 2016

Over half a million people have now visited The 8th Asia Pacific Triennial of Contemporary Art (APT8) at the Queensland Art Gallery/Gallery of Modern Art (QAGOMA), with the Gallery welcoming its 500,000th visitor in the past week.

QAGOMA Director Chris Saines, who presented the lucky visitor and her family with a complimentary one-year Gallery membership and copies of exhibition publications, commented “since the record breaking attendance on the opening night last November, visitors have embraced this Triennial’s exploration of art from the region.”

Queensland Premier Annastacia Palaszczuk said APT8 appealed to all ages, with children comprising 20% of attendees.

Premier Palaszczuk stated “more than 109 000 young visitors have engaged with the exhibition’s dynamic APT8 Kids program.

“The geographical scope of booked school visits has been one of the widest ever with children travelling from as far south as Victoria.

“APT8 continues the series’ long-term success as a proven cultural tourism generator.’

“The Queensland Government is the Gallery’s primary supporter and the impact of the APT demonstrates the importance of Queensland Government investment in the arts sector for economic, social and cultural outcomes.”

APT8 Cinema at the Gallery’s Australian Cinémathèque has reached new audiences with close to 4000 people attending screenings for programs including ‘Pop Islam’ and ‘Filipino Indie’.

Over 32,200 visitors have experienced APT8 Live – the monthly series of performances and talks that expand on the exhibition’s themes. APT8 Live continues this weekend, 20 March, when visitors can participate in sound workshops with artists Super Critical Mass, see QUT dance students perform Gabriella Mangano and Silvana Mangano’s 2015 work There is no there, and hear from performance art specialists in discussion forums.

Visitors can also enjoy tunes by Dub Temple Records DJs and a special food and bar menu from 2.30-5.00pm at the GOMA Cafe Bistro. The final APT8 Live coincides with the closing weekend of the exhibition – 9 and 10 April.

APT8 traverses both the Queensland Art Gallery and the Gallery of Modern Art and includes major installations and work by leading artists from Asia and the Pacific. The Gallery’s flagship contemporary art event has garnered national and international coverage for its ground breaking model and ambitious scale.

APT8 features works by over 80 artists from more than 30 countries. Entry to every component of the exhibition is free.

APT8 closes on 10th April.
